The brakes in your car consist of a “pump” (master cylinder) that you operate with your foot (brake pedal) connected by brake line tubing to a hydraulic cylinder (wheel cylinder) that pushes the brake shoes against the brake drum or disc brake caliper & rotor. The hydro-boost uses the hydraulic pressure from the power steering system to provide the driver assist in applying the brakes.
